The All Children’s Art Center of New Jersey (ACACNJ) is a nonprofit organization committed to nurturing creativity, confidence, and community in children through the arts. Our programs go far beyond the stage—from theatre productions and engaging weekly events to tailored birthday parties, art workshops, summer camps, and our popular Kids’ Night Out evenings. At ACACNJ, every child is given the chance to express themselves, explore new passions, and make lifelong memories in a fun, inclusive environment.

Georgine La Serna is the visionary founder of the All Children’s Art Center of New Jersey. A certified teacher along with a Master’s in Business, she brings a rare blend of educational insight and entrepreneurial drive. Georgine has led ACACNJ since 2018, creating dynamic arts programs that empower children through creativity, confidence, and community. Her background spans arts education, business leadership, and public service—making her a passionate advocate for accessible, engaging, and joyful experiences for every child.

Mackenzie Cavagnaro is a recent graduate of New York University's Tisch School of the Arts where she earned her BFA in Drama at the Stella Adler Studio of Acting and the Experimental Theatre Wing. She spent this past Summer teaching Improv and serving as the Assistant Director for the Comedy Ensemble at Traveling Players Ensemble in Tysons, Virginia. With a passion for bringing theatre education to kids of all ages and backgrounds, she has also worked as an assistant drama teacher at the High School of Economics and Finance in New York City, as well as a Music Theatre Teacher at the Summer Onstage Camp at Ady Art Center in Livingston, New Jersey. When she’s not teaching, you can find her performing comedy at Gotham Comedy Club, or doing some good ole’ arts and crafts! She is very excited to be working with All Children’s Art Center to share her love of theatre with all of you!

Samara (Sammi) Fishkin graduated Drew University, Magna Cum Laude with Specialized Honors in Theater Arts. Samara has been acting since she was four years old, all over Morris County. She has been directing and choreographing at All Children’s Art Center since December of 2023, enjoying every second of it! Prior to that she had been a theater Camp Director for six years, directing theater for both the younger set as well as teens. During these years, she has written, directed and choreographed multiple shows and has even found time to be in productions herself to keep her knowledge of the “other side”, fresh. Samara recently performed In a local production of The Little Mermaid and prior to that, a lead in a staged reading of an Oxnam Award winning play, with actors and a Director from New York’s Ensemble Studio Theater. Samara’s energetic personality will fill the theater with enthusiasm, kindness and a loving passion for theater. Samara’s motto is to have fun while learning!
